The Prime Minister Kurti discussed at the World Economic Forum in Davos

January 19, 2023

Davos, Switzerland, 19 January 2023

At the World Economic Forum that is being held in Davos, Switzerland, the Prime Minister of the Republic of Kosovo, Albin Kurti, discussed in the session the topic “Dialogue of Diplomacy for the Western Balkans”.

Prime Minister Kurti presented the achievements of the Republic of Kosovo in 2022, economic and democratic progress. He emphasized the need to dynamize the dialogue process towards the full normalization of relations between Kosovo and Serbia, with mutual recognition at the center.

In this session, Prime Minister Kurti discussed alongside: Edi Rama, Prime Minister of Albania, Alexander Schallenberg, Federal Minister for European and International Affairs of Austria, Miroslav Lajčák, Special Representative of the European Union for the Kosovo-Serbia Dialogue, Borjana Krišto, President-designate of Council of Ministers of Bosnia and Herzegovina, Andrej Plenkovic, Prime Minister of Croatia, Mikuláš Bek, Minister for European Affairs of the Czech Republic, Bernard Emié, Director General for External Security, Ministry of the Armed Forces of France, Dritan Abazović, Prime Minister Montenegro, Stevo Pendarovski, President of North Macedonia, Aleksandar Vučić, President of Serbia, Tanja Fajon,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Foreign Affairs of Slovenia, Ignazio Cassis, Federal Counselor for Foreign Affairs of Switzerland, Odile Françoise Renaud-Basso, President of the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development (EBRD), London, as well as Achim Steiner, Administrator, United Nations Development Program (UNDP), New York.

This session with participants of leading countries and international organizations was chaired by Børge Brende, President of the World Economic Forum, while it was led by Mirek Dušek, managing director of the World Economic Forum.
